Output 615afc01efa119091cd04ec2a3e8676876f47228e06c2afd4695675988310cf6:1

value
24786369
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7e576f8666d1b39d715d3a57b588eacc2a7c80fa OP_EQUALVERIFY OP_CHECKSIG
address
1CX2tJjSpVk35huSrD6bUMGfLrkkked84a
transaction
615afc01efa119091cd04ec2a3e8676876f47228e06c2afd4695675988310cf6
confirmations
398109
spent
true